- Senior Production Editor

Department: Programming
Location: Tucson, Arizona
Hours: 40+(Full-Time, Exempt)

Job Summary:

The Senior Production Editor delivers radio production elements and spots marked by indisputable excellence in relation to the broadcast quality standards, mission and vision, and branding for the different ministries of Family Life Communications.

No relocation assistance provide for this position.

Essential Functions:

  • Actively participates in campaign planning meetings by leading or contributing with creative, effective ideas that support the goals of various, diverse campaigns and the strategic initiatives of Family Life Radio; creates comprehensive production proposals that meet the needs of new promotional initiatives
  • Creates scripts and digital audio productions using standard DAW software, employing effective technical solutions within the DAW context
  • Creates radio productions that complement other traditional and new media tools utilized in FLC campaigns
  • Assures all completed production delivers indisputable excellence within budget
  • Manages all assigned projects and production schedules independently using standard project management software, delivering all projects on-time every time, and
  • Organizes hard-drive digital assets according to a finely detailed structure that enables efficient asset management and archiving

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

  • Proven creative and innovative "out-of-the-box" thinker; demonstrates knowledge of effective, contemporary radio production methods and tools used industry-wide
  • Demonstrated knowledge of general marketing principles; complements larger marketing initiatives employed in campaigns
  • Knowledge and proven ability to edit audio utilizing multi-track editing software on a PC platform; strong skills in using SONY Vegas and Sound Forge, Adobe Audition, or equivalent applications. Able to cross-train on similar DAW applications
  • Proven ability to write listener-focused production scripts that delivers results
  • Proven ability to direct voice talent performance that meet the high quality goals of the production
  • Proven project management skills: ability to plan and perform complex work in a fast paced work environment where only general policies or procedures are available
  • Strong PC skills including proficiency with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int)
  • Strong organizational, interpersonal and decision-making skills
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ills including ability to write, edit and proof business documents
  • Strong presentation skills
  • Very high level of commitment to delivering compelling radio to the target listener
  • Self-motivated starter who sets and achieves personal objectives
  • Proven "stickler" for details that positively impact high quality production

Qualifications and Other Requirements:

  • Bachelor's degree from a four-year college or university and, or combination of education and experience
  • Five (5) years professional, creative script-writing and radio producing experience using multi-track DAW applications and PCs
